Tom Absalom

Managing Director, JCA Engineering

Tom has worked within the data centre industry for over 30 years (before it was called the data centre industry!!) having served an indentured apprenticeship with the leading UK manufacturer of data centre cooling products. A mechanical engineer by discipline, his career has provided a wide range of experience encompassing manufacturing, production engineering, product design (including UK, European and US patents) and more broadly M&E services design and build for critical environments.

To enhance commercial competence and to complement his engineering experience Tom completed his MBA in 2004. In 2006 Tom joined JCA, an owner-managed multi-faceted engineering company where he currently holds the position of Managing Director. He is responsible for all aspects of the business including the engineering divisions that provide design, project and maintenance services to a wide range of clients not just within the data centre sector but also healthcare, science and technology and commercial services.

As well as thriving on the challenges that operating the business generates, Tom is fully involved in the delivery of services to clients on a day-to-day basis and enjoys nothing more than engaging in the engineering detail.
